Scope and Contents From the Collection: The W. Jett Lauck collection consists of his professional, business and personal papers as an economist, statistician and government consultant on immigration, banking, railroads, coal, and unemployment problems as well as other facets of labor in the United States. Included are correspondence, scrapbooks of news clippings reflecting his activities, labor reports and studies, drafts of congressional bills, legal briefs, and other material concerning labor problems in the United States from...

Sleeping Car Conductors Case – Exhibits, 3 folders, 1927-1928

 File — Box: 133, Folder: 5-7
Scope and Contents

Exhibits include “An Adequate Basic Wage,” “Earnings of Sleeping Car Conductors compared with Changes in the Cost of Living,” “Various Factors Indicating Rising Standards of Living in the United States Since 1914,” “Compensation of Sleeping Car Conductors compared with other Expenses and Revenue of the Pullman Company,” and “General Trend of Wages, 1913-1918, as Compared with Earnings of Sleeping Car Conductors.”

Dates: 1927-1928
